【廣告】
軟件開發(fā)是什么,該怎么做(四)?企業(yè)管理軟件開發(fā)費(fèi)用
企業(yè)管理軟件開發(fā)費(fèi)用2.2.2規(guī)劃創(chuàng)建軟件程序的一個(gè)重要任務(wù)是提取需求或需求分析,客戶通常對(duì)他們想要的終結(jié)果有一個(gè)抽象的想法,但不知道軟件應(yīng)該做什么。熟練而有經(jīng)驗(yàn)的軟件工程師會(huì)在這一點(diǎn)上認(rèn)識(shí)到不完整的、模糊的、甚至是相互矛盾的需求。雖然在需求階段投入了大量的精力來確保需求的完整和一致性,但現(xiàn)實(shí)中很難做到這一點(diǎn)。需求的波動(dòng)性對(duì)軟件開發(fā)很有挑戰(zhàn)性,因?yàn)樗鼈儠?huì)影響到未來或正在進(jìn)行中的開發(fā)工作。一旦從客戶那里收集到一般需求,就應(yīng)該確定并明確說明開發(fā)的范圍分析。這通常被稱為范圍文件。2.2.3設(shè)計(jì)需求確定后,可以在軟件設(shè)計(jì)文檔中確定軟件的設(shè)計(jì)。這涉及到主要模塊的初步設(shè)計(jì)或高j設(shè)計(jì),并對(duì)各部分如何組合在一起進(jìn)行總體規(guī)劃。語(yǔ)言、操作系統(tǒng)和硬件組件在這時(shí)都應(yīng)該是已知的企業(yè)管理軟件開發(fā)費(fèi)用。接下來就是創(chuàng)建一個(gè)詳細(xì)的或低級(jí)的設(shè)計(jì),可能是作為概念驗(yàn)證或確定需求的原型設(shè)計(jì)。功能實(shí)現(xiàn)、測(cè)試和記錄功能實(shí)現(xiàn)是軟件工程師實(shí)際為項(xiàng)目編寫代碼的過程中的一個(gè)部分。軟件測(cè)試是軟件開發(fā)過程中不可或缺的重要階段。這一部分的過程確保了缺陷盡快被識(shí)別出來。在某些過程中,通常被稱為測(cè)試驅(qū)動(dòng)開發(fā),測(cè)試可能就在功能實(shí)現(xiàn)之前就已經(jīng)制定好了,并作為驗(yàn)證功能實(shí)現(xiàn)的方法。在整個(gè)開發(fā)過程中,對(duì)軟件的內(nèi)部設(shè)計(jì)進(jìn)行文檔化,以便于將來的維護(hù)和改進(jìn)。這包括編寫外部的和內(nèi)部的API文檔。開發(fā)團(tuán)隊(duì)所選擇的軟件工程過程將決定有多少內(nèi)部文檔是必要的。計(jì)劃驅(qū)動(dòng)的模式(例如,瀑布模式)通常比敏捷模式產(chǎn)生的文檔多。企業(yè)管理軟件開發(fā)費(fèi)用
軟件開發(fā)是什么,該怎么做?企業(yè)管理軟件開發(fā)費(fèi)用
企業(yè)管理軟件開發(fā)費(fèi)用2.3.3計(jì)算機(jī)輔助軟件工程計(jì)算機(jī)輔助軟件工程(Computer-aidedsoftwareengineering,簡(jiǎn)稱CASE),在軟件工程領(lǐng)域,是指將一套軟件工具和方法科學(xué)地應(yīng)用到軟件開發(fā)中,從而獲得高質(zhì)量、無缺陷、可維護(hù)的軟件產(chǎn)品,也是指在軟件開發(fā)過程中,與自動(dòng)化工具一起用于信息系統(tǒng)開發(fā)的方法。CASE的功能包括分析、設(shè)計(jì)和編程等。CASE工具用所需的編程語(yǔ)言自動(dòng)設(shè)計(jì)、記錄和制作結(jié)構(gòu)化的計(jì)算機(jī)代碼的方法。計(jì)算機(jī)輔助軟件系統(tǒng)工程(CASE)的兩個(gè)重要思想是:·培養(yǎng)軟件開發(fā)和軟件維護(hù)過程中的計(jì)算機(jī)協(xié)助,以及·培養(yǎng)軟件開發(fā)和維護(hù)的一種工程化方法。典型的CASE工具有配置管理、數(shù)據(jù)建模、模型轉(zhuǎn)換、重構(gòu)、源碼生成等。2.3.4集成開發(fā)環(huán)境集成開發(fā)環(huán)境(IDE)又稱為集成設(shè)計(jì)環(huán)境或企業(yè)管理軟件開發(fā)費(fèi)用集成調(diào)試環(huán)境,是指為計(jì)算機(jī)程序員提供軟件開發(fā)的綜合設(shè)施的軟件應(yīng)用。一個(gè)集成開發(fā)環(huán)境通常由以下幾個(gè)部分組成:·源代碼編輯器?!ぞ幾g器或解釋器?!?gòu)建自動(dòng)化工具,以及·調(diào)試器(通常)。IDE的設(shè)計(jì)目的是通過提供具有類似用戶界面的緊密組件來大限度地提高程序員的工作效率。通常情況下,IDE是專門針對(duì)特定的編程語(yǔ)言而設(shè)計(jì)的,以便提供符合該語(yǔ)言編程范式的功能集。企業(yè)管理軟件開發(fā)費(fèi)用
軟件開發(fā)簡(jiǎn)介企業(yè)管理軟件開發(fā)費(fèi)用
一、軟件的定義軟件是指系統(tǒng)中的程序以及開發(fā)、使用程序所需要的所有文檔的集合,軟件是一種邏輯產(chǎn)品,具有無形性,是腦力勞動(dòng)的結(jié)晶,軟件產(chǎn)品整個(gè)開發(fā)過程是通過人腦進(jìn)行的邏輯思維完成的,其無形化的特征給軟件開發(fā)和生產(chǎn)過程的管理帶來不便,進(jìn)度難以控制,軟件開發(fā)質(zhì)量難以評(píng)價(jià)和保證;同時(shí)軟件也是信息商品,包括功能性和性能的說明性信息,如使用維護(hù)說明、指南以及培新教材等,軟件有質(zhì)量、成本、交貨期、使用壽命的要求,是極具競(jìng)爭(zhēng)性的商品,投入的資金主要是人工費(fèi)用,開發(fā)時(shí)間越長(zhǎng),成本陡增就會(huì)使軟件變得毫無競(jìng)爭(zhēng)力企業(yè)管理軟件開發(fā)費(fèi)用
二、軟件的分類軟件分為系統(tǒng)軟件和應(yīng)用軟件,系統(tǒng)軟件是負(fù)責(zé)管理計(jì)算機(jī)系統(tǒng)中各種獨(dú)立的硬件,使得他們可以協(xié)調(diào)工作,一般來講系統(tǒng)軟件主要包括操作系統(tǒng)、網(wǎng)絡(luò)系統(tǒng)、程序設(shè)計(jì)語(yǔ)言的編譯系統(tǒng)和實(shí)用工具軟件;應(yīng)用軟件是為了某種特定的用途而被開發(fā)的軟件,可以是一個(gè)特定的程序,比如一個(gè)圖形瀏覽器,也可以是一組功能聯(lián)系緊密,可以相互協(xié)作的程序集合,比如數(shù)據(jù)量管理系統(tǒng),應(yīng)用軟件主要包括:信息管理軟件、實(shí)時(shí)控制軟件、科學(xué)計(jì)算數(shù)據(jù)處理軟件、人工智能軟件、嵌入式軟件和多媒體軟件。企業(yè)管理軟件開發(fā)費(fèi)用
三、應(yīng)用軟件定制開發(fā)應(yīng)用定制軟件開發(fā)是指根據(jù)客戶的需求而開發(fā)的應(yīng)用軟件。定制應(yīng)用軟件,由于多種原因不能大批量生產(chǎn),而是面向特定應(yīng)用領(lǐng)域、滿足特定功能需求。軟件開發(fā)過程常常試圖在定制軟件的基礎(chǔ)上,尋求共性需求,以滿足類似應(yīng)用,提高軟件的使用價(jià)值,間接降低軟件研發(fā)成本;而通用軟件如開發(fā)工具、字表處理等軟件,也越來越滿足個(gè)性化的設(shè)置需要,以謀求進(jìn)一步推廣應(yīng)用領(lǐng)域。定制軟件通用化、通用軟件可定制,是軟件開發(fā)的重要目的之一軟件定制一般是指企業(yè)管理或是軟件的定制,中小企業(yè)可根據(jù)自身實(shí)際業(yè)務(wù)需求,定制開發(fā)一套適合自己的軟件,定制軟件開發(fā)周期短,不要求一次性開發(fā)完成,這樣可以減少投入。
礦井生產(chǎn)調(diào)度系統(tǒng)建設(shè)方案
3.12巷道日常管理
3.12.1掘進(jìn)班組匯報(bào)
功能描述:參與掘進(jìn)生產(chǎn)的各區(qū)隊(duì),每天每班可通過此模塊上報(bào)出勤人數(shù)、進(jìn)尺數(shù)、異常情況匯報(bào)、使用材料情況等進(jìn)行錄入,上報(bào)到集團(tuán)調(diào)度室,進(jìn)行數(shù)據(jù)的統(tǒng)計(jì)分析及問題的處理。
3.12.2月底進(jìn)尺驗(yàn)收
功能描述:煤礦生產(chǎn)過程中,每到月底進(jìn)行巷道進(jìn)尺情況的驗(yàn)收,通過此模塊管理驗(yàn)收數(shù)據(jù),上報(bào)相關(guān)部門進(jìn)行審核,為決策分析提供層,準(zhǔn)確的數(shù)據(jù)來源。
3.12.3中腰線管理
功能描述:對(duì)中腰線的信息進(jìn)行管理,參與中腰線標(biāo)定的部門將中腰線信息進(jìn)行維護(hù),并可下發(fā)到部門,指導(dǎo)生產(chǎn)。
3.13巷道竣工驗(yàn)收
3.13.1竣工驗(yàn)收申請(qǐng)
功能描述:巷道竣工后,由所施工的工區(qū)提出驗(yàn)收申請(qǐng)。錄入驗(yàn)收的基礎(chǔ)信息,提交驗(yàn)收申請(qǐng),流轉(zhuǎn)到驗(yàn)收的檢查程序。提供新增、編輯、刪除、查詢、打印、附件上傳等功能。
3.14竣工驗(yàn)收檢查
功能描述:竣工驗(yàn)收的初步審查結(jié)束后,要對(duì)初查問題進(jìn)行跟蹤,進(jìn)行驗(yàn)收的復(fù)查工作,錄入復(fù)查情況信息。
3.15竣工驗(yàn)收管理
功能描述:對(duì)所有的巷道竣工驗(yàn)收情況進(jìn)行管理,對(duì)所有投產(chǎn)信息進(jìn)行展示。
3.16輔助工區(qū)班組匯報(bào)
3.16.1班組匯報(bào)
功能描述:對(duì)煤礦生產(chǎn)中,運(yùn)輸部門、機(jī)電部門等輔助工區(qū)的班組情況進(jìn)行匯報(bào),填寫車運(yùn)、鉤數(shù)、皮帶運(yùn)行時(shí)間等匯報(bào)信息,提交后,調(diào)度室可以進(jìn)行查看。